How much do commission remote fertility j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for commission remote fertility in the United States is $21.50,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.03 and $22.84 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Director of Sales, Healthcare - Remote
Strengthening and empowering all of the communities we serve.
Remote-based position - ideally located in Midwest or Southeast but not required.
Our client is seeking a proven Director of Sales, Healthcare to lead and scale a high-performing sales organization within the healthcare category. This role is designed for an experienced sales leader who thrives in a fast-paced, consultative environment and has a strong track record of building, coaching, and inspiring teams to deliver sustained revenue growth.
As Director of Sales, Healthcare, you will be responsible for setting the sales vision, driving strategic and profitable growth, and ensuring excellence across the full healthcare sales lifecycle. You will leverage deep knowledge of healthcare marketing, digital advertising, regulatory considerations, and patient engagement strategies to deliver innovative, data-driven solutions that produce measurable outcomes for healthcare organizations.
Compensation for this position is comprised of a base salary plus commission compensation. The base salary range is $105,000 - $150,000 per year. Additional commissions bring total potential target compensation to $161,000-$210,000.
Key responsibilities of the Sales Director include:?
  • Profitable Growth: Meet or exceed revenue targets by leading high-performing teams with rigor, holding teams accountable to performance metrics, pursuing top prospects with discipline and aligning client needs to their KPIs to ensure competitive success.
  • Strategic Leadership: Develop and execute sales strategies tailored to healthcare clients, leveraging proprietary and third-party digital offerings including display, video, email, social, search, SEO, OTT/CTV, DOOH and sponsorships.?
  • Talent Development: Coach and build a high-performing sales team with healthcare-specific knowledge. Foster a culture of innovation, collaboration and continuous learning to achieve common objectives.?
  • Data-as-a-Service Expertise: Drive adoption of data-driven solutions, including audience segmentation, data integration and predictive analytics to help healthcare clients optimize outreach and ROI.?
  • AI Integration: Champion the use of AI tools to enhance campaign personalization, sales enablement and forecasting. Identify opportunities that accelerate growth in the healthcare vertical.?
  • Client Success Focus: Ensure top-tier client results through consultative selling, strategic planning, and cross-functional alignment with marketing, operations and data teams.?

To be considered for this position you should have:
  • Bachelor's degree in business, marketing or related field
  • Minimum ten years' proven successful sales experience, with at least five years' sales leadership experience in building and coaching sales teams?
  • Five or more years of healthcare sales experience preferred, or equivalent expertise in digital marketing Consistent, proven history of exceeding sales goals and driving profitable revenue growth?
  • Ability to lead, inspire and motivate a diverse sales team?
  • Exceptional communication, interpersonal, negotiation and presentation skills?
  • Proven analytical skills to analyze and interpret sales data to inform strategic decisions and drive data-driven solutions?
  • High proficiency with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software and sales tracking and performance software?

This is a remote role requiring reliable transportation for regular client meetings, team engagements, and industry events
